Barton-on-Humber train station may lack a ticket office and ticket machines, but it compensates with serene simplicity. For those purchasing tickets, it's crucial to plan ahead and buy tickets online given the absence of ticket collection facilities. They do provide an induction loop for passengers requiring hearing assistance. However, travelers should be aware that there are no staff available for assistance and no luggage storage facilities, so packing efficiently and planning is key.
Accessibility is also a priority here with step-free access available across the station, ensuring smooth transit for wheelchair users. Though basic, the station provides a help point and customer assistance hotline (08002006060) for any inquiries. With no toilets or refreshment facilities on-site, make sure to prepare accordingly before starting your journey.
Despite its somewhat limited facilities, Barton-on-Humber's connectivity through transport links is commendable. The station offers a rail replacement service with pick-up and drop-off at the bus turning circle outside the station. Up-to-date journey planning resources are accessible online, ideal for those continuing their journey by bus or other transport modes. You can find a printable guide for these connections here.

The station is design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. Although there isn't a ticket office on site, fear not, as ticket vending machines are readily available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. These machines, however, lack accessibility features. Should you require further assistance, customer help points are positioned strategically throughout the site. Keep in mind that if you require detailed staff assistance, it would be advisable to plan ahead since there are no staff help available at the station.
For those concerned about accessibility, the station is classified as category 'A', meaning it offers step-free access to all platforms. You can also find a helpful ramp for train access and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. However, some facilities such as toilets, accessible toilets, and baby changing areas are not available.
Although there are no retail outlets within the station, you won't be left wanting when it comes to adjacent infrastructure. Cyclists will be pleased to find sheltered bicycle racks right next to the entrance, under the watchful eye of CCTV. Bicycle hire services are on offer too, providing a green option for onward travel.
Stratford-upon-Avon Parkway's transport links make it easy to continue with your journey. Bus services are available for those looking to make their way to Stratford-upon-Avon town centre, particularly through the Park & Ride scheme. Additionally, in the event of rail service disruptions, replacement buses are planned to operate directly from the station's forecourt next to the entrance.
If cycling is your passion, you might want to explore the Brompton bike hire service, a convenient option for those looking to pedal their way through the scenic lanes of Warwickshire.
